As you join the Apache Cloudberry project, it’s important to understand the distinctions between projects and products within the context of the Apache Software Foundation (ASF). Here's an overview to set expectations and guide your journey. What is Apache Cloudberry? Apache Cloudberry is an open-source project under the ASF, focused on producing freely available source code. Key highlights: The project will produce source code releases and may optionally provide deployable binaries (binary convenience artifacts). Any binaries released are offered without any warranty and are not intended to meet the needs of customers requiring enterprise-grade support. Neutral Development: Neither the source code nor binaries are tied to a specific country. Apache Cloudberry is a collaborative global project under the ASF, a U.S.-based non-profit organization. Independent from Influence: ASF projects operate free from corporate or government control, ensuring neutrality and transparency. Licensing and ASF Support Apache License: Apache Cloudberry is distributed under the Apache License, which explicitly disclaims any warranties or guarantees of support. Community Support: Volunteers may assist through mailing lists or forums, but assistance is not guaranteed and is provided at their discretion.
